What Does a Remote Logo Designer Do?

A Filipino logo designer crafts distinctive brand marks, wordmarks, and visual identity elements that make businesses instantly recognizable. These creative professionals combine typography, color theory, and symbolism to develop logos that communicate brand values and resonate with target audiences. Filipino logo designers are proficient in Adobe Illustrator, Photoshop, and vector design tools, delivering scalable logo files in all required formats — SVG, PNG, EPS, and PDF. They create comprehensive style guides that define logo usage rules, color palettes, typography hierarchies, and spacing guidelines to ensure brand consistency across every touchpoint. Many Filipino designers have studied graphic design or fine arts and built portfolios spanning tech startups, restaurants, fashion brands, real estate firms, and nonprofits. Salary Expectations

Typical monthly salary ranges for remote Filipino logo designers working with international clients.

Entry Level

₱34,000 – ₱49,000

per month

Mid Level

₱49,000 – ₱66,500

per month

Senior Level

₱66,500 – ₱84,000

per month

What file formats will I receive for my logo?
Filipino logo designers deliver comprehensive file packages including vector formats (SVG, AI, EPS) for scalability, raster formats (PNG, JPEG) for web and social media, and PDF for print. You also receive variations — full color, black and white, reversed, and favicon versions — ready for every application.
How many logo concepts will a Filipino designer provide?
Most Filipino logo designers on PinoyMatch present 3-5 initial concepts based on your creative brief. After you select a direction, they refine the chosen concept through multiple revision rounds until you are fully satisfied. This iterative process ensures your final logo aligns perfectly with your brand identity.

How do I brief a remote logo designer effectively?
Provide your Filipino designer with a detailed brief covering your business description, target audience, competitors, preferred colors and styles, and examples of logos you admire. Use Figma or Google Slides for visual references. Clear communication upfront leads to better initial concepts and fewer revision rounds.
